Welcome to Northern Lights: Canadian Women in Tech & Business, where we spotlight the incredible journeys of Canada's most trailblazing women--Alyson is a Senior Vice President at Wasserman, where she leads strategic growth initiatives and client partnerships in sports and entertainment. She previously served as Chief Commercial Officer and SVP of Business at OverActive Media, overseeing global partnerships, marketing, and operations for one of the world’s leading esports organizations. Earlier, she was Vice President of Brand Partnerships & Client Strategy at Bell Media, where she developed innovative content and data solutions for top advertisers, and held leadership roles at Maple Leaf Sports & Entertainment and the Canadian Olympic Committee, contributing to major milestones such as the 2010 Vancouver Olympic Games. Beyond her executive work, Alyson is a Board Member of Wise Toronto, where she champions the advancement of women in sports business, and serves as a Senior Advisor and Mentor at the Future of Sport Lab, supporting innovation and research in the industry.
